Output b807581a74bd7112ec5b5a7d66aa72d092e1066c5dd41de07e974edf80628e53:1

value
1614600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 619c95f5e016852d8c70573d80cb74324c7b6f18 OP_EQUAL
address
DE3Dfdtt8cK8WQpyPFmPWwSNjQjhLZ446i
transaction
b807581a74bd7112ec5b5a7d66aa72d092e1066c5dd41de07e974edf80628e53
spent
true